Overview

Featuring Wi-Fi in all rooms, the 3-star Dillington House Hotel Ilminster is approximately 25 minutes' walk from Ilminster Warehouse Theartre. The hotel offers 40 rooms and amenities such as a restaurant.

Location

You'll need 47-minute drive to Exeter International airport. Church Of St Mary The Virgin is merely 0.9 miles away, and Glastonbury is 17 miles from this Ilminster hotel. The property is about a 10-minute drive from Barrington Court.
